[quote=Anonymous]I lived on the route of a major marathon and while we could walk across the road between packs, we couldn’t drive. All the side roads were open to local traffic, so I could get in and out if my side-loading driveway. That being said, the crews were FAST to open the road after the majority were through and made the stragglers run in a “lane” where cars normally parked. That was a well-run marathon, though. What time is the bike race? I find that a lot of them start at 7 or 8 and the roads are back open by 9 or 10. It’s inconvenient, but you shouldn’t be trapped. [/quote]
